WordPress最適化究極ガイド:あらゆる方向からウェブサイトのスピードとパフォーマンスを向上させる実践的戦略

2分で読了
2026-03-13
2026-06-03
2,980
以下のリンクからお買い物をしていただくと、コミッションを差し上げます。.

ウェブサイトの速度とパフォーマンスは、ユーザー体験や検索エンジンのランキングに直接影響を与えます。読み込みに時間がかかるWordPressサイトでは、ユーザーの離脱率が大幅に増加し、コンバージョンの機会が失われてしまいます。このガイドでは、基礎から高度な内容まで、検証済みのWordPress最適化戦略を体系的に紹介します。これにより、高速でスムーズ、かつ安定したウェブサイトを構築することができます。

サーバー環境とコア基盤の最適化

高層ビルも平地から建てられるように、ウェブサイトの最適化も堅牢なサーバーや基本的な設定から始めなければなりません。基礎的な最適化を怠ると、その後の作業の効果は大幅に低下してしまいます。

WordPressのコアとサーバーの選択

まず、WordPressのコア、テーマ、およびすべてのプラグインが最新の状態にあることを確認してください。開発チームは継続的にバグやセキュリティの脆弱性を修正し、パフォーマンスの向上も図っています。次に、高性能なホスティング環境を選択することが非常に重要です。共有ホスティングは安価ですが、リソースの分離や安定性においては通常、専用のホスティングサービスに劣ります。ある程度のトラフィックやパフォーマンスが求められるウェブサイトの場合は、少なくとも専用のサーバーを提供するホスティングサービスを選ぶことをお勧めします。専用サーバーは、通常、従来のサーバーよりも静的ファイルの処理やプロセス管理の能力が優れています。

推薦図書 WordPressの最適化を徹底的にマスターする:速度からパフォーマンスまでの究極の戦略

PHPのバージョンとデータベースの最適化

最新かつ安定したバージョンを使用することは、パフォーマンスを向上させるための最も直接的で効果的な方法の一つです。バージョン7.4以降では、旧バージョンと比較して実行速度が大幅に向上しています。ホストコントロールパネルでバージョンを確認し、アップグレードすることができます。また、データベース内の冗長なデータ(修正版、下書き、不要なコメントなど)を定期的に削除することも重要です。この作業を安全に行うために、専用のプラグインを使用することができます。さらに、データベーステーブルにインデックスを追加することもクエリ速度を向上させるための鍵となりますが、多くの最適化プラグインがこの問題を自動的に処理してくれます。

UltaHostのWordPressホスティングサービス
30日間の返金保証、無制限の帯域幅とデータベースサービス、無料のDDoS防御機能が付きます。3年契約をすると、501TPから4Tまでのプランで割引が適用されます。

フロントエンドのロードパフォーマンス最適化

ユーザーがあなたのウェブサイトにアクセスすると、ブラウザはサーバーからHTML、CSS、JavaScript、画像、フォントなどのリソースをダウンロードする必要があります。これらのリソースの転送と読み込み方法を最適化することが、ユーザーが感じる速度を向上させる鍵となります。

画像およびメディアファイルの最適化

未圧縮の画像は、ウェブサイトのサイズが肥大化する主な原因です。アップロードする前に、画像圧縮ツールなどを使用して必ず画像を圧縮してください。WordPressでは、プラグインをインストールすることでアップロードされた画像を自動的に圧縮したり、WebP形式に変換したりすることができます。また、ラズリーローディング(lazy loading)技術を利用すると、ユーザーが画面に近づいたときにのみ画像や動画が読み込まれるため、初期ページの読み込み負荷を大幅に軽減できます。多くの現代のテーマにはこの機能が標準で搭載されており、プラグインを使っても同様の効果を得ることができます。

コードリソースの統合と最小化

CSSやJavaScriptファイルを統合し、サイズを最小限に抑えることで、リクエストの数を減らし、ファイルの容量を削減することができます。例えば、プラグインを使用するとこの機能を簡単に実現できます。このプラグインはファイルを自動的に統合・最小化し、ヘッダーやフッターに配置する(非同期または遅延ロード)、レンダリングパスを最適化することができます。さらに高度な制御が必要な場合(未使用のCSSを削除するなど)は、このような総合的なキャッシュ最適化プラグインを検討するとよいでしょう。

<!-- Autoptimize 的典型配置示例(概念性) -->
<!-- 它会将多个CSS文件合并为一个,并最小化 -->
<link rel="stylesheet" href="wp-content/cache/autoptimize/css/autoptimize_123abc.css" />

コンテンツ配信ネットワークを利用する。

CDN(Content Delivery Network)は、あなたの静的リソース(画像、CSS、JS、フォント)を世界中のエッジサーバーにキャッシュします。ユーザーがこれらのリソースにアクセスすると、CDNはユーザーに最も近いサーバーからファイルを提供するため、遅延を低減し、世界中のユーザーの読み込み速度を大幅に向上させます。人気のあるCDNサービスには、などがあります。これらのサービスには無料プランや強力なセキュリティ機能も提供されています。

推薦図書 ワードプレスの最適化のための完全ガイド: 速度向上からSEOの高度なテクニックまでの実践的なヒント

効率的なキャッシュ戦略の実施

キャッシュはWordPressの最適化において不可欠な要素です。キャッシュは静的なHTMLページを生成して保存することで、リソースを多く消費する処理やデータの検索処理を回避し、サーバーの応答時間を大幅に短縮します。

ページキャッシュとブラウザキャッシュ

ページキャッシュはキャッシング戦略の核心です。LiteSpeedを使用している場合など、便利なキャッシングプラグインを使えば簡単に設定できます。これらのプラグインは、動的なページから静的なHTMLコピーを自動的に生成してくれます。ブラウザのキャッシング機能は、HTTPヘッダーを設定することで実現され、ブラウザに画像やCSSなどの静的なリソースを一定期間ローカルに保存させます。そのため、有効期限内にユーザーが再度アクセスする際にはリソースを再ダウンロードする必要がありません。これは、ファイルにルールを追加するか、キャッシングプラグインを使用することで実現できます。

# 在 .htaccess 中设置浏览器缓存过期时间的示例(Apache服务器)
<IfModule mod_expires.c>
  ExpiresActive On
  ExpiresByType image/jpg "access plus 1 year"
  ExpiresByType image/jpeg "access plus 1 year"
  ExpiresByType image/gif "access plus 1 year"
  ExpiresByType image/png "access plus 1 year"
  ExpiresByType text/css "access plus 1 month"
  ExpiresByType application/javascript "access plus 1 month"
</IfModule>

オブジェクトキャッシュとOPコードキャッシュ

データベースへのクエリが頻繁に発生するウェブサイト(例えば大規模なショッピングモールやフォーラムなど)にとって、オブジェクトキャッシングは大きなメリットをもたらします。オブジェクトキャッシングはデータベースのクエリ結果をメモリに保存し、同じクエリが再度発生した場合にはメモリから直接データを読み取るため、データベースへの負荷を大幅に軽減します。ほとんどのホスティングサービスではこの機能が提供されており、設定も比較的簡単です。また、サーバーでこの機能が有効になっていることを確認してください。これは標準で搭載されているバイトコードキャッシングモジュールであり、事前にコンパイルされたPHPスクリプトのバイトコードをメモリに保存することで、実行ごとにスクリプトを再読み込みや再解析する必要がなくなり、多くのリソースを節約できます。

hosting.com 共有ホスティング
AMD EPYC CPU、NVMe SSDストレージ、LiteSpeedによる高いパフォーマンス、24時間365日の専門家による社内サポート、SSL、ブルートフォース、マルウェア、DDoS保護などの高度なセキュリティ対策、最大73%のコスト削減

バックエンドおよびプラグイン管理の最適化

肥大化したバックエンドや大量の低品質なプラグインは、ウェブサイトのパフォーマンスを低下させ、セキュリティ上の脆弱性を引き起こす隠れた原因となります。バックエンドの最適化や管理プロセスの改善も同様に重要です。

分析と厳選されたプラグイン

インストールしているプラグインを定期的に確認してください。もはや必要ない、またはその機能が他の方法で代替できるプラグインは無効にして削除してください。プラグインはすべて、余分なリクエスト、データベースのクエリ、コードの実行を増加させます。新しいプラグインを選ぶ際には、頻繁にアップデートされ、評価が高く、コードの品質が良い製品を優先してください。開発作業においては、この強力なプラグインを使用してパフォーマンスのボトルネックを診断したり、データベースのクエリやフック、リクエスト、エラーを確認したりすることができ、問題の正確な原因を特定するのに役立ちます。

不必要なバックグラウンド機能を無効にする

WordPressのコアには、すべてのウェブサイトで必要とされるわけではない機能が含まれています。例えば、記事の修正履歴やEmojiのサポート、RSSフィードなどです。これらの機能を適度に無効にすることで、データベースの肥大化や余分なスクリプトの読み込みを抑えることができます。テーマのファイルにコードを追加するか、このような管理用プラグインを使用して、これらの機能をオン/オフに切り替えることができます。

推薦図書 WordPress最適化の究極ガイド:ウェブサイトの速度とパフォーマンスを向上させる20の実用的なコツ

例えば、記事の修正履歴のバージョン数を制限したい場合は、ファイルに以下のような内容を追加することができます:

// 在 wp-config.php 中定义修订版本的最大数量
define('WP_POST_REVISIONS', 5);
// 或完全禁用
// define('WP_POST_REVISIONS', false);

概要

WordPressの最適化は、サーバー、コード、リソース、設定に関わる体系的な作業であり、一朝一夕に完了するものではありません。まずは適切なホストとPHPのバージョンを選択して基盤を固め、次に画像の最適化やコードの簡素化、CDNを利用してフロントエンドの読み込み速度を向上させます。その後、ページキャッシュ、オブジェクトキャッシュ、OPcacheを活用して効率的なキャッシュシステムを構築します。さらに、プラグインの管理を徹底し、バックエンドの最適化を行うことで、ウェブサイトの軽量性を維持します。これらの戦略を継続的に実施することで、ウェブサイトの速度、パフォーマンス、ユーザー体験が大幅に向上し、検索エンジンや訪問者の間でより良い評価を得ることができるでしょう。

インターサーバー共有ホスティング
共有ホスティング月$2.50米ドル, 最初の月$0.1米ドルプロモーションコードtryinterserver, 461クラウドアプリケーションスクリプト, 1クリックインストール.

FAQ よくある質問

### 技術的な知識がないのですが、WordPressサイトの最適化をどのように始めればいいでしょうか?

まずは統合的な最適化プラグインの使用から始めると良いでしょう。このようなプラグインにはユーザーフレンドリーなグラフィカルインターフェースが備わっており、ページキャッシュ、ブラウザキャッシュ、ファイルの最小化、ラズリーロードなど、さまざまな核心的な最適化機能が統合されています。ほとんどの設定は数回のクリックだけで完了できるため、初心者に非常に適しています。

複数の最適化プラグインを使用すると、ウェブサイトの動作が遅くなったり、プラグイン同士で衝突が発生する可能性がありますか?

はい。これは最適化プロセスで非常によく見られる問題です。複数のプラグインが機能が重複している場合(例えば、どちらのプラグインもCSSを最小限に抑えようとする場合)、互いに衝突し、最適化が失敗したり、ウェブサイトにエラーが発生したりする可能性があります。ベストプラクティスとしては、できるだけ機能が充実している優れたプラグインをメインに選び、その機能に特化したプラグイン(例えばデータベースのクリーニング用のプラグイン)を1つか2つ組み合わせることです。新しいプラグインをウェブサイトに導入する前には、必ずウェブサイトの(テスト)環境でテストを行うようにしてください。

なぜウェブサイトの速度テストツール(例えばPageSpeed Insights)が出すスコアやアドバイスが時に矛盾するのでしょうか?

異なるテストツール(Google PageSpeed Insights、GTmetrix、WebPageTestなど)では、テストを行う場所、ネットワーク環境、評価アルゴリズム、テストの焦点が異なる場合があります。これらのツールが提供するアドバイスは診断のための指針であり、必ずしも厳守しなければならないルールではありません。実際のユーザー体験を最優先の指標とし、複数のテストツールのレポートを組み合わせて、多くのツールで共通して指摘されている問題(例えば「使用されていないJavaScriptの削減」や「適切なサイズの画像の使用」)に注目するべきです。あるツールで満点を目指すのではなく、これらの問題を解決することに焦点を当てるべきです。

优化后网站速度仍然不理想,可能是什么原因?

もし上記の最適化策を実施した後でもページの読み込み速度が改善されない場合、問題はより根本的な部分にある可能性があります。まず、ホストサーバーの性能を確認してください。リソース(CPUやメモリ)が不足している可能性があります。次に、プラグインやテーマのコード品質が非常に悪く、パフォーマンスのボトルネックとなっている可能性があります。この場合は、プラグインを使って問題の特定を行うとよいでしょう。最後に、外部から埋め込まれたリソース(第三者の広告コード、フォント、ソーシャルメディアのプラグインなど)の読み込みが遅いためにページ全体の速度が低下しているかどうかを確認してください。